Earl Wayne Lowe, age 82, of Columbus Junction, Iowa, passed away on Tuesday, April 14, 2026, at Wapello Specialty Care in Wapello, Iowa, following a short illness.
Funeral services will be held at 10:30 a.m. on Monday, April 20, 2026, at the United Church of Crawfordsville, with Pastor Jason Collier officiating. Interment will follow at Crawfordsville Cemetery. Calling hours will begin at 1:00 p.m. on Sunday, April 19, 2026, at the church, with the family present to receive friends from 2:00 to 4:00 p.m. Memorials have been established for the United Church of Crawfordsville and the WACO Food Pantry. Wayne was born on March 4, 1944, at home in Crawfordsville, Iowa, the son of Earl and Ina Mae (Walker) Lowe. He attended school in Crawfordsville through 11th grade, graduating from Ainsworth High School in 1962. He proudly served in the Iowa National Guard. On December 27, 1970, Wayne married Deborah Trevitt in Mediapolis, Iowa.
Wayne lived his entire life on the family farm east of Crawfordsville, where he farmed all of his life, taking over the operation in 1970. He enjoyed attending horse and cattle sales and produce auctions in Kalona, socializing with friends at the Crawfordsville feed store, and especially liked mushroom hunting and coyote hunting. Wayne was also a member of the United Church of Crawfordsville.
Wayne will be deeply missed by his wife of over 55 years, Debbie Lowe, of Columbus Junction, Iowa; his two daughters: Karen (Lance) Brisky of Lodi, Wisconsin, and Renee Lowe of Cheyenne, Wyoming; granddaughter, Kaelyn (Sam) Burke of Rochester, Minnesota; grandson, Adrian Brisky (friend, Kayla Klobucnik) of Crawfordsville, Iowa; granddaughter, Jordan Brisky (friend, Reese Priebe) of Lakeville, Minnesota; great-granddaughter, Stella Sue Burke of Rochester, Minnesota; and sister, Patricia (Mike) Klopfenstein of Cheyenne, Wyoming; along with several nieces and nephews.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Earl and Ina Mae Lowe; and brother, Allen “Jigger” Lowe.
The family extends their sincere gratitude to the University of Iowa Hospitals & Clinics, Wapello Specialty Care, and Care Initiatives Hospice for the compassionate care they provided to Wayne during his illness.
